Structure of human Mnk2 Kinase Domain mutant D228G
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 16216586
About this Structure
2ac5 is a 1 chain structure with sequence from Homo sapiens.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
Reference
- Jauch R, Jakel S, Netter C, Schreiter K, Aicher B, Jackle H, Wahl MC. Crystal structures of the Mnk2 kinase domain reveal an inhibitory conformation and a zinc binding site. Structure. 2005 Oct;13(10):1559-68. PMID:16216586 doi:10.1016/j.str.2005.07.013
